Acronyms have long been a familiar way for bike firms to crow about tech but long before terms like SRAD or DCT became familiar on two wheels the term RADAR – RAdio Direction And Ranging – had been coined.

Read more…

Leave a Reply

Your email address will not be published. Required fields are marked *